360/1007 = ≈35.75%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A value like 360/1007, or about 35.75%, could describe how many students in a school take the bus, how often a product is discounted, or the share of a budget used for one expense. It represents a little more than one-third of the whole.
To picture it quickly, imagine a group of 100 people: about 36 of them would fit this fraction. Since one-third is about 33.3%, 35.75% is slightly higher than one-third but clearly less than one-half.
A common mistake is treating 35.75% as if it means 35.75 out of 1007, when it means about 35.75 out of every 100. Also, the fraction is not exactly 35.75%; that percentage is a rounded estimate.
